New Communication Director Anthony Scaramucci today vowed to crack down on leaks from the White House, threatening to fire everyone, if necessary, to stop aides from leaking information.

Scaramucci, the Wall Street financier who joined the administration last week, claimed that he has "a thousand per cent" authorisation from US President Donald Trump to do so.

"I am going to fire everybody, that is how I am going to do it," Scaramucci said.

Soon thereafter Michael Short, one of the assistant press secretaries to the US President in the White House press office, resigned. His resignation came not before the media reported that Short has been fired, thus making him the first casualty of the new White House Communication Director.
